A user openly shares a risky investment decision amid significant losses in their cryptocurrency portfolio. The decision to invest in $babyansem, a coin without clear utility or a roadmap, raises eyebrows within the community, further fueling ongoing debates about crypto strategies.
In a post, the individual admitted to studying various aspects of cryptocurrency for years, only to invest in a coin described simply as "what if Ansem, but a baby." With a striking lack of clarity around $babyansem's value proposition, many in the community express concern over such speculative investments.
"Just a diaper and a dream," the user highlighted, poking fun at the absurdity while also claiming a modest 12% gain post-investment. This raises questions: how sustainable is such a whimsical investment approach?
The transaction ignited varied responses on forums, revealing a mix of skepticism and incredulity:
Contrast in Sentiments: Several users reacted negatively, suggesting a mix of desperation and folly. Comments include remarks like, "This is one of the most desperate and cringe posts Iβve seen in a while" and "Thatβs about as dumb as it gets. Congrats."
Support for Risk-Taking: Other voices, however, displayed a more accepting attitude towards high-risk investments, with one commenter saying, "Welcome to the casino. Also no crying in the casino."
Reflection on the Space: A notable critique stated, "Crypto was an interesting societal experiment and Iβm glad our species has moved on to other things.β This sentiment reflects the broader disillusionment among some in the crypto scene.
